一、开启idea自动make功能
在StackOverFlow找到这么一段
引用
1 - Enable Automake from the compiler
PRESS: CTRL + SHIFT + A
TYPE: make project automatically
PRESS: Enter
Enable Make Project automatically feature
2 - Enable Automake when the application is running
PRESS: CTRL + SHIFT + A
TYPE: Registry
Find the key compiler.automake.allow.when.app.running and enable it
Note: Restart your application now
两步:
1、CTRL + SHIFT + A --> 查找make project automatically --> 选中
2、CTRL + SHIFT + A --> 查找Registry --> 找到并勾选compiler.automake.allow.when.app.running
最后重启idea
二、使用spring-boot-1.3开始有的热部署功能
1、加maven依赖
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-devtools</artifactId>
<optional>true</optional>
</dependency>
2、开启热部署
<build>
<plugins>
<plugin>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-maven-plugin</artifactId>
<configuration>
<fork>true</fork>
</configuration>
</plugin>
</plugins>
</build>
三、Chrome禁用缓存
F12(或Ctrl+Shift+J或Ctrl+Shift+I)--> NetWork --> Disable Cache(while DevTools is open)
至此,在idea中就可以愉快的修改代码了,修改后可以及时看到效果,无须手动重启和清除浏览器缓存
分享到:
相关推荐
它能够动态更新有关热部署的规则。联系请随时与以下联系人询问我任何问题。 Drools视频教程: : 常问问题1)演示? 2)为什么我不能在开发环境中动态更新规则? 在开发阶段,不建议使用Intellij IDEA之类的工具进行...
IntelliJ IDEA不重启tomcat,自动部署 热发布Spring Boot
对本人博客中《Spring Boot实践之三 在IDEA中使用Spring Initializr方式构建Spring Boot项目》和《Spring Boot实践之四 在IDEA中使用Spring Initializr方式构建的Spring Boot项目进行单元测试和热部署》的源代码内容...
主要介绍了idea配置springboot热部署终极解决办法(解决热部署失效问题),本文通过实例代码给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友参考下吧
添加依赖 <groupId>org.springframework.boot <artifactId>spring-boot-devtools <optional>true <scope>true </dependency>
①部署Spring Boot开发环境 ②熟悉Idea工具的使用 ③创建Spring Boot程序 ④单元测试 ⑤配置热部署
主要介绍了Spring Boot 配置 IDEA和DevTools 热部署的方法,需要的朋友可以参考下
spring-boot-devtools是一个为开发者服务的一个模块,其中最重要的功能就是自动应用代码更改到最新的App上面去。,这篇文章主要介绍了SpringBoot项目在IntelliJ IDEA中如何实现热部署,感兴趣的小伙伴们可以参考一下
主要介绍了spring boot devtools在Idea中实现热部署方法及注意要点,需要的朋友可以参考下
JAVA Spring Boot教程合集+项目源代码_极品.zip intellij启动两个端口的相同spring boot工程 ...SpringBoot项目在IntelliJ IDEA中实现热部署 Springboot修改启动端口的3种方式 基于Spring Boot的RESTful API
主要介绍了Springboot在IDEA热部署的配置方法,给大家补充介绍了Intellij IDEA 4种配置热部署的方法,需要的朋友可以参考下
《JavaEE开发的颠覆者: Spring Boot实战》从Spring 基础、Spring MVC 基础讲起,从而无难度地引入Spring Boot 的学习。涵盖使用Spring Boot 进行Java EE 开发的绝大数应用场景,包含:Web 开发、数据访问、安全控制...
《JavaEE开发的颠覆者: Spring Boot实战》从Spring 基础、Spring MVC 基础讲起,从而无难度地引入Spring Boot 的学习。涵盖使用Spring Boot 进行Java EE 开发的绝大数应用场景,包含:Web 开发、数据访问、安全控制...
《JavaEE开发的颠覆者: Spring Boot实战》从Spring 基础、Spring MVC 基础讲起,从而无难度地引入Spring Boot 的学习。涵盖使用Spring Boot 进行Java EE 开发的绝大数应用场景,包含:Web 开发、数据访问、安全控制...
开发工具为idea2019,数据库使用的mysql5.7,数据库连接池菜哦采用druid,数据库框架采用mybatis,java版本使用的jdk1.7,引入了spring-boot-devtools热部署插件便于开发过程中调试,jar包管理采用了maven框架。...
主要介绍了IntelliJ IDEA中SpringBoot项目通过devtools实现热部署的方法,本文分步骤给大家介绍的非常详细,具有一定的参考借鉴价值,需要的朋友可以参考下
idea+springboot+oracle+mybatis,集成的demo样例,开发测试用
SpringBoot(powernode) 一、第一个SpringBoot项目 ...五、Spring Boot热部署 5.1 什么是热部署 5.2 添加依赖 5.3 配置idea的启动面板 六、Spring Boot的配置文件语法 6.1 首先引入依赖 6.2 创建Weapon类 6.3 pro
1、热部署: org.springframework.boot spring-boot-devtools true idea默认是没有自动编译的,我们这里需要添加修改配置.打开设置 (1)File-Settings-Compiler-Build Project automatically (2)ctrl + shift +...
主要介绍了idea+ springboot熱部署的配置方法,本文通过实例代码给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友可以参考下